@@ -21,6 +21,7 @@ import java.util.List;
*/
@Component
public interface ProjectMapper extends MyMapper<Project> {
+ void updateProject(ProjectDTO dto);
List<ProjectVO> getProjects(ProjectDTO dto);
SbInfoTypeReportVO2 getSbNums(ProjectDTO dto);
@@ -135,11 +135,12 @@
<select id="getProjects" parameterType="com.platform.dao.dto.project.ProjectDTO"
resultType="com.platform.dao.vo.query.project.ProjectVO">
select project.* from t_project project
- where flag is null
+ where flag is null or flag = -1
or flag = #{flag}
</select>
+
</mapper>
@@ -18,6 +18,8 @@ import java.util.List;
* @Version Copyright (c) 2019,北京乾元坤和科技有限公司 All rights reserved.
public interface ProjectService extends IBaseService<Project, ProjectDTO> {
public List<ProjectVO> selectVOList(ProjectDTO model);
/**
* 分页查询
@@ -40,6 +40,11 @@ public class ProjectServiceImpl extends BaseServiceImpl<ProjectMapper, Project,
return 1;
}
+ @Override
+ public void modModelByDTO(ProjectDTO model) {
+ mapper.updateProject(model);
+ }
@Override
public List<ProjectVO> selectLongYanList(ProjectDTO dto) {
return mapper.selectLongYanList(dto);